How can you help?
1-Spay or neuter your pets and help stop pet overpopulation. {Last year, over 5,000 cats and dogs were killed in RI public and private shelters because there are not enough homes. That is equal to 14 dogs and cats every day of the year!} There are several great low-cost programs in RI, such as Salmon River Veterinary Services. Also, RI Veterinary Medical Association

Low cost spay/neuter clinics for cats are held every other Tuesday at the Warwick Animal Shelter by appointment only. Please call 401-468-4377 to make an appointment or for more information.

In Rhode Island, all owned cats must be spayed or neutered according to law. These clinics give cat owners a low-cost option by a very experienced and caring veterinarian, Dr Ryan Loiselle of Salmon River Veterinary Services. Please be sure to spay/neuter your cats-animal shelters all over RI are overflowing with homeless cats. Please, don't let you cat contribute to the problem.
